Antioch township is located in Wexford County, Michigan. Antioch township has a 2026 population of 914. Antioch township is currently growing at a rate of 0.33% annually and its population has increased by 1.78%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 898 in 2020.
The median household income in Antioch township is $65,972 with a poverty rate of 13.61%. The median age in Antioch township is 38.3 years: 43.8 years for males, and 34.6 years for females. For every 100 females there are 104.1 males.

The racial composition of Antioch township includes 91.59% White, and smaller percentages for Black or African American, other race, Native American and multiracial populations.

Antioch township's average per capita income is $40,972. Household income levels show a median of $65,972. The poverty rate stands at 13.61%.
Name | Median | Mean |
|---|---|---|
| Married Families | $80,208 | - |
| Families | $76,071 | $83,388 |
| Households | $65,972 | $74,674 |
| Non Families | $38,750 | $46,148 |
